Most importantly, your college experience is when you learn uncountable life lessons. Here are five things college will teach you, whether you realize it or not.
1. Balance
Nothing teaches you balance like having six classes, a job, a relationship, friends to cater to, a position in Greek life, and living on your own. We may think that we have our shit together now, but balance is key to surviving college and the rest of your life.
2. Don't sweat the small stuff
Being a senior in college I have just now realized how much time I’ve taken out of my day to stress about things that are simply out of my control. Whether it’s transferring schools, project deadlines, friendships, work, or fitting in, stress has gotten the best of us sometimes. Don’t sweat the small stuff because, quite frankly, you won’t remember half the things you stressed about years from now.
3. Independence
College means living on your own. It means learning how to do your laundry, live with another human being in a very small space, how to cook and grocery shop. Although it may seem sucky to learn these things on your own, the rewards of being independent are indescribable. It teaches you to have a sudden appreciation for your parents and the things you once never knew how to do.
4. Appreciation for your hometownNothing is worse than having to MapQuest your way to the grocery store, the mall or a friend’s house. College teaches you to have an appreciation for the town you know like the back of your hand. Even more, it makes you appreciate the people in that little town and all of the memories you shared.
5. You can do this
Nobody prepared you for the sleepless nights or the mini breakdowns you were bound to experience in college, the homesickness or the desire for somewhere familiar to drive to. Despite the challenges you face, you’ll learn a lot in college; who you are, who you want to be and how important it is to keep pushing forward. You can do this, whether you believe it or not.
